Meh the video recorder refuses to capture anything OpenGL render related, it just stays black in that place/window and it's the only one that records and restores at fullspeed despite CPU stress.
I have the feeling, and I guess I'm not wrong, that JPCSP uses somekind of a smart frameskip method that gets triggered only when it's not 60fps to try to mentain full speed even with fps drops compared to other emulators that get enabled and constantly skip and draw a specific number of frames or get disabled and have speed loss in case of fps drop. Even though it may have the best experience result out of all, it looks like GPUs don't like at all this idea and it causes that non-sync jitter when combined to a conflicting behaviour of something else like VSync. Also it's not just Nvidia that I have this jitter effect, I have it on every card I tried JPCSP (Intel,AMD,Nvidia) but it's just that Nvidia is the one that does it specificaly on cube demo.
